Exploring Amber Fort’s Architectural Marvels
Your first stop inside will likely be the Sheesh Mahal (Mirror Palace)—a highlight for many visitors. Its walls, covered in tiny mirrors, reflect even the dimmest light in a way that feels almost magical. Several reviews mention the “breathtaking” beauty of this hall, and it’s easy to see why.
Next, wander through the Diwan-i-Aam and Diwan-i-Khas, the public and private audience halls. These spaces showcase Mughal craftsmanship, with intricately carved ceilings and detailed inlay work. Your guide will point out features that might go unnoticed otherwise, enriching your understanding of the architecture.
You’ll also visit the Sukh Niwas, a cooling chamber that’s thought to have had some kind of ancient air-conditioning system—an impressive feat for the 16th century. From here, you’ll move towards the Ganesh Pol, a grand gateway offering sweeping views of Maota Lake. This spot provides some of the best photo opportunities, especially when the sunlight hits the water and the distant hills.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Is the tour suitable for all ages?
It’s best for those who are comfortable walking and climbing stairs, as the fort involves some uneven terrain. It’s not ideal for travelers with mobility impairments.
Can I skip the optional elephant or jeep ride?
Yes, the ride is optional. If you prefer to walk or want to save money, you can skip it without affecting the main tour.
What languages are guides available in?
Guides can speak English, French, Spanish, Russian, and Japanese, providing flexibility for international travelers.
How long is the tour?
The tour lasts approximately 3 hours, including transportation, guided exploration, and scenic viewing time.
Is this experience family-friendly?
Yes, as long as children are comfortable walking and climbing stairs. However, very young children might find the terrain challenging.
What should I wear or bring?
Comfortable shoes are recommended for walking on uneven surfaces. Sunscreen, a hat, and water are advisable, especially in warmer months.
Can I customize the tour?
Since it’s a private experience, you can discuss with your guide about extending your visit or focusing on specific areas of interest.
